Everyone could use a break from social media — even Bayern Munich and German national star Jamal Musiala.
In a recent interview, Musiala noted that he makes sure to pick up his phone less these days.
“I’ve definitely reduced my social media consumption in the past year. I think it’s quite normal to look at the comments after a good game. But I try to stay away from social media. There’s always that one comment that can spoil your mood,” Musiala told Sports Illustrated (as captured by @iMiaSanMia).
And to think…Musiala is one of the popular footballers. Checking your mentions for an unpopular player after a bad game must be a nightmare.
